2015 House Bill 4657

Mandate environmental assessments for new schools

Introduced in the House

May 27, 2015

Introduced by Rep. Stephanie Chang (D-6)

To prohibit building a new school unless a preliminary assessment is done to discover whether any hazardous substances are on the property, and if this indicates there are, to undertake the extensive cleanup procedures specified under state environmental law. The bill also adds a variety of public notice requirements.

Referred to the Committee on Education
